Course structure

• Introduction to Nuclear Energy Safety Procedures
• Radiation Protection and Shielding
• Reactor Operation and Control
• Emergency Response and Accident Mitigation
• Regulatory Compliance and Licensing
• Safety Analysis and Risk Assessment
• Waste Management and Decommissioning
• Human Factors in Nuclear Safety
• Instrumentation and Control Systems
• Safety Culture and Communication in Nuclear Facilities
